public final class com.sun.tools.javap.resources.javap_zh_CN extends java.util.ListResourceBundle
minor version: 0
major version: 59
flags: flags: (0x0031) ACC_PUBLIC, ACC_FINAL, ACC_SUPER
this_class: com.sun.tools.javap.resources.javap_zh_CN
super_class: java.util.ListResourceBundle
{
public void <init>();
descriptor: ()V
flags: (0x0001) ACC_PUBLIC
Code:
stack=1, locals=1, args_size=1
start local 0 0: aload 0
invokespecial java.util.ListResourceBundle.<init>:()V
return
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 1 0 this Lcom/sun/tools/javap/resources/javap_zh_CN;
protected final java.lang.Object[][] getContents();
descriptor: ()[[Ljava/lang/Object;
flags: (0x0014) ACC_PROTECTED, ACC_FINAL
Code:
stack=7, locals=1, args_size=1
start local 0 0: bipush 48
anewarray java.lang.Object[]
dup
iconst_0
1: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.bad.constant.pool"
aastore
dup
iconst_1
ldc "\u8BFB\u53D6{0}\u7684\u5E38\u91CF\u6C60\u65F6\u51FA\u9519: {1}"
aastore
aastore
dup
iconst_1
2: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.bad.innerclasses.attribute"
aastore
dup
iconst_1
ldc "{0}\u7684 InnerClasses \u5C5E\u6027\u9519\u8BEF"
aastore
aastore
dup
iconst_2
3: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.cant.find.module"
aastore
dup
iconst_1
ldc "\u627E\u4E0D\u5230\u6A21\u5757 {0}"
aastore
aastore
dup
iconst_3
4: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.cant.find.module.ex"
aastore
dup
iconst_1
ldc "\u67E5\u627E\u6A21\u5757 {0} \u65F6\u51FA\u73B0\u95EE\u9898: {1}"
aastore
aastore
dup
iconst_4
5: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.class.not.found"
aastore
dup
iconst_1
ldc "\u627E\u4E0D\u5230\u7C7B: {0}"
aastore
aastore
dup
iconst_5
6: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.crash"
aastore
dup
iconst_1
ldc "\u51FA\u73B0\u4E25\u91CD\u7684\u5185\u90E8\u9519\u8BEF: {0}\n\u8BF7\u5EFA\u7ACB Bug \u62A5\u544A, \u5E76\u5305\u62EC\u4EE5\u4E0B\u4FE1\u606F:\n{1}"
aastore
aastore
dup
bipush 6
7: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.end.of.file"
aastore
dup
iconst_1
ldc "\u8BFB\u53D6{0}\u65F6\u51FA\u73B0\u610F\u5916\u7684\u6587\u4EF6\u7ED3\u5C3E"
aastore
aastore
dup
bipush 7
8: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.file.not.found"
aastore
dup
iconst_1
ldc "\u627E\u4E0D\u5230\u6587\u4EF6: {0}"
aastore
aastore
dup
bipush 8
9: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.incompatible.options"
aastore
dup
iconst_1
ldc "\u9009\u9879\u7EC4\u5408\u9519\u8BEF: {0}"
aastore
aastore
dup
bipush 9
10: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.internal.error"
aastore
dup
iconst_1
ldc "\u5185\u90E8\u9519\u8BEF: {0} {1} {2}"
aastore
aastore
dup
bipush 10
11: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.invalid.arg.for.option"
aastore
dup
iconst_1
ldc "\u9009\u9879\u7684\u53C2\u6570\u65E0\u6548: {0}"
aastore
aastore
dup
bipush 11
12: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.invalid.use.of.option"
aastore
dup
iconst_1
ldc "\u9009\u9879\u7684\u4F7F\u7528\u65E0\u6548: {0}"
aastore
aastore
dup
bipush 12
13: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.ioerror"
aastore
dup
iconst_1
ldc "\u8BFB\u53D6{0}\u65F6\u51FA\u73B0 IO \u9519\u8BEF: {1}"
aastore
aastore
dup
bipush 13
14: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.missing.arg"
aastore
dup
iconst_1
ldc "\u6CA1\u6709\u4E3A{0}\u6307\u5B9A\u503C"
aastore
aastore
dup
bipush 14
15: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.no.SourceFile.attribute"
aastore
dup
iconst_1
ldc "\u6CA1\u6709 SourceFile \u5C5E\u6027"
aastore
aastore
dup
bipush 15
16: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.no.classes.specified"
aastore
dup
iconst_1
ldc "\u672A\u6307\u5B9A\u7C7B"
aastore
aastore
dup
bipush 16
17: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.nomem"
aastore
dup
iconst_1
ldc "\u5185\u5B58\u4E0D\u8DB3\u3002\u8981\u589E\u5927\u5185\u5B58, \u8BF7\u4F7F\u7528 -J-Xmx \u9009\u9879\u3002"
aastore
aastore
dup
bipush 17
18: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.not.standard.file.manager"
aastore
dup
iconst_1
ldc "\u4F7F\u7528\u6807\u51C6\u6587\u4EF6\u7BA1\u7406\u5668\u65F6\u53EA\u80FD\u6307\u5B9A\u7C7B\u6587\u4EF6"
aastore
aastore
dup
bipush 18
19: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.prefix"
aastore
dup
iconst_1
ldc "\u9519\u8BEF:"
aastore
aastore
dup
bipush 19
20: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.source.file.not.found"
aastore
dup
iconst_1
ldc "\u627E\u4E0D\u5230\u6E90\u6587\u4EF6"
aastore
aastore
dup
bipush 20
21: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"err.unknown.option"
aastore
dup
iconst_1
ldc "\u672A\u77E5\u9009\u9879: {0}"
aastore
aastore
dup
bipush 21
22: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.bootclasspath"
aastore
dup
iconst_1
ldc " -bootclasspath <\u8DEF\u5F84> \u8986\u76D6\u5F15\u5BFC\u7C7B\u6587\u4EF6\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 22
23: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.c"
aastore
dup
iconst_1
ldc " -c \u5BF9\u4EE3\u7801\u8FDB\u884C\u53CD\u6C47\u7F16"
aastore
aastore
dup
bipush 23
24: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.class_path"
aastore
dup
iconst_1
ldc " --class-path <\u8DEF\u5F84> \u6307\u5B9A\u67E5\u627E\u7528\u6237\u7C7B\u6587\u4EF6\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 24
25: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.classpath"
aastore
dup
iconst_1
ldc " -classpath <\u8DEF\u5F84> \u6307\u5B9A\u67E5\u627E\u7528\u6237\u7C7B\u6587\u4EF6\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 25
26: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.constants"
aastore
dup
iconst_1
ldc " -constants \u663E\u793A\u6700\u7EC8\u5E38\u91CF"
aastore
aastore
dup
bipush 26
27: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.cp"
aastore
dup
iconst_1
ldc " -cp <\u8DEF\u5F84> \u6307\u5B9A\u67E5\u627E\u7528\u6237\u7C7B\u6587\u4EF6\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 27
28: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.help"
aastore
dup
iconst_1
ldc " -? -h --help -help \u8F93\u51FA\u6B64\u5E2E\u52A9\u6D88\u606F"
aastore
aastore
dup
bipush 28
29: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.l"
aastore
dup
iconst_1
ldc " -l \u8F93\u51FA\u884C\u53F7\u548C\u672C\u5730\u53D8\u91CF\u8868"
aastore
aastore
dup
bipush 29
30: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.module"
aastore
dup
iconst_1
ldc " --module <\u6A21\u5757>, -m <\u6A21\u5757> \u6307\u5B9A\u5305\u542B\u8981\u53CD\u6C47\u7F16\u7684\u7C7B\u7684\u6A21\u5757"
aastore
aastore
dup
bipush 30
31: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.module_path"
aastore
dup
iconst_1
ldc " --module-path <\u8DEF\u5F84> \u6307\u5B9A\u67E5\u627E\u5E94\u7528\u7A0B\u5E8F\u6A21\u5757\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 31
32: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.multi_release"
aastore
dup
iconst_1
ldc " --multi-release <version> \u6307\u5B9A\u8981\u5728\u591A\u53D1\u884C\u7248 JAR \u6587\u4EF6\u4E2D\u4F7F\u7528\u7684\u7248\u672C"
aastore
aastore
dup
bipush 32
33: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.p"
aastore
dup
iconst_1
ldc " -p -private \u663E\u793A\u6240\u6709\u7C7B\u548C\u6210\u5458"
aastore
aastore
dup
bipush 33
34: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.package"
aastore
dup
iconst_1
ldc " -package \u663E\u793A\u7A0B\u5E8F\u5305/\u53D7\u4FDD\u62A4\u7684/\u516C\u5171\u7C7B\n \u548C\u6210\u5458 (\u9ED8\u8BA4)"
aastore
aastore
dup
bipush 34
35: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.protected"
aastore
dup
iconst_1
ldc " -protected \u663E\u793A\u53D7\u4FDD\u62A4\u7684/\u516C\u5171\u7C7B\u548C\u6210\u5458"
aastore
aastore
dup
bipush 35
36: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.public"
aastore
dup
iconst_1
ldc " -public \u4EC5\u663E\u793A\u516C\u5171\u7C7B\u548C\u6210\u5458"
aastore
aastore
dup
bipush 36
37: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.s"
aastore
dup
iconst_1
ldc " -s \u8F93\u51FA\u5185\u90E8\u7C7B\u578B\u7B7E\u540D"
aastore
aastore
dup
bipush 37
38: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.sysinfo"
aastore
dup
iconst_1
ldc " -sysinfo \u663E\u793A\u6B63\u5728\u5904\u7406\u7684\u7C7B\u7684\n \u7CFB\u7EDF\u4FE1\u606F\uFF08\u8DEF\u5F84\u3001\u5927\u5C0F\u3001\u65E5\u671F\u3001SHA-256 \u6563\u5217\uFF09"
aastore
aastore
dup
bipush 38
39: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.system"
aastore
dup
iconst_1
ldc " --system <jdk> \u6307\u5B9A\u67E5\u627E\u7CFB\u7EDF\u6A21\u5757\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 39
40: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.upgrade_module_path"
aastore
dup
iconst_1
ldc " --upgrade-module-path <\u8DEF\u5F84> \u6307\u5B9A\u67E5\u627E\u53EF\u5347\u7EA7\u6A21\u5757\u7684\u4F4D\u7F6E"
aastore
aastore
dup
bipush 40
41: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.v"
aastore
dup
iconst_1
ldc " -v -verbose \u8F93\u51FA\u9644\u52A0\u4FE1\u606F"
aastore
aastore
dup
bipush 41
42: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.opt.version"
aastore
dup
iconst_1
ldc " -version \u7248\u672C\u4FE1\u606F"
aastore
aastore
dup
bipush 42
43: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age"
aastore
dup
iconst_1
ldc "\u7528\u6CD5: {0} <options> <classes>\n\u5176\u4E2D, \u53EF\u80FD\u7684\u9009\u9879\u5305\u62EC:"
aastore
aastore
dup
bipush 43
44: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age.foot"
aastore
dup
iconst_1
ldc "\nGNU \u6837\u5F0F\u7684\u9009\u9879\u53EF\u4F7F\u7528 '=' (\u800C\u975E\u7A7A\u767D) \u6765\u5206\u9694\u9009\u9879\u540D\u79F0\n\u53CA\u5176\u503C\u3002\n\n\u6BCF\u4E2A\u7C7B\u53EF\u7531\u5176\u6587\u4EF6\u540D, URL \u6216\u5176\n\u5168\u9650\u5B9A\u7C7B\u540D\u6307\u5B9A\u3002\u793A\u4F8B:\n path/to/MyClass.class\n jar:file:///path/to/MyJar.jar!/mypkg/MyClass.class\n java.lang.Object\n"
aastore
aastore
dup
bipush 44
45: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"main.usage.summary"
aastore
dup
iconst_1
ldc "\u7528\u6CD5\uFF1A{0} <\u9009\u9879> <\u7C7B>\n\u4F7F\u7528 --help \u5217\u51FA\u53EF\u80FD\u7684\u9009\u9879"
aastore
aastore
dup
bipush 45
46: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"note.prefix"
aastore
dup
iconst_1
ldc "\u6CE8:"
aastore
aastore
dup
bipush 46
47: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"warn.prefix"
aastore
dup
iconst_1
ldc "\u8B66\u544A:"
aastore
aastore
dup
bipush 47
48: iconst_2
anewarray java.lang.Object
dup
iconst_0
ldc "warn.unexpected.class"
aastore
dup
iconst_1
ldc "\u6587\u4EF6 {0} \u4E0D\u5305\u542B\u7C7B {1}"
aastore
aastore
49: areturn
end local 0 LocalVariableTable:
Start End Slot Name Signature
0 50 0 this Lcom/sun/tools/javap/resources/javap_zh_CN;
}
SourceFile: "javap_zh_CN.java"